The Board

Established in 1975 under Supreme Court Rule 14, the Board of Certified Court Reporter Examiners is comprised of four members of The Missouri Bar who are judges of the circuit or appellate courts and three court reporters who have served a minimum of five years as official reporters in Missouri courts prior to appointment. All board members are appointed by the Supreme Court and each serves a three-year term. Members may be reappointed by the Court.

The Examination

A certification examination is conducted at least semiannually, one in the spring and one in the fall.

Certification

Conditions of continued certification status include:
1) Payment of annual renewal fee
2) Reporting of continuing education credits

Employment

Effective January 1, 2002, all court reporters, whether official or free-lance, must be certified in accordance with Supreme Court Rule 14. Following is a list of certified court reporters in good standing as well as temporary reporters:


Once certified, individuals may choose to seek employment in a variety of workplaces: Missouri courts, state agencies, private reporting firms, hospitals/medical centers, educational institutions, the media industry, or as entrepreneur. Those interested in working as officials in the Missouri court system should contact circuit judges and judicial administrators in the counties and judicial circuits in which they are seeking employment.
